Description: One of downtown’s newer gems, this lovely, free sculpture garden in Western Gateway, operated by the Des Moines Art Center, is a lovely place to stroll among an eclectic selection of artwork. The pieces here are largely modern, including William de Kooning’s Reclining Figure, a fine example of abstract expressionism, and Barry Hannah’s whimsical Thinker on a Rock, which may give children visions of Alice in Wonderland. Take your time moseying along to appreciate the sculptures along the winding paths. One of the most popular spots is at Jaume Piensa’s Nomade, a large, open figure where you can stand and examine the pileup of painted white metal letters that make up the sculpture (although touching the sculptures is not allowed, with the exception of Scott Burton’s Seating for Eight and Cafe Table I, a minimalist circle of chairs that’s a nice place to take a break from walking). Guided tours of the sculpture garden are available Apr. 1 through Oct. 1—contact the art center at (515) 271-0328 to arrange a tour. Three or more weeks’ advance notice is required to schedule a guided tour, for which there is a fee.
